Understanding Steroids: Types, Uses, and Risks

Steroids are synthetic substances that mimic the effects of naturally occurring hormones in the body, particularly testosterone. They are widely known for their role in increasing muscle mass and enhancing athletic performance. However, the use of steroids is controversial due to their potential side effects and legal implications. This article aims to provide an overview of steroids, their types, uses, benefits, and associated risks.

Types of Steroids

Steroids can be classified into different categories based on their chemical structure and intended use. The two primary types include:

  1. Anabolic Steroids: These are synthetic derivatives of testosterone that promote muscle growth and enhance physical performance. Athletes and bodybuilders often use them to increase strength and improve recovery time.
  2. Corticosteroids: Unlike anabolic steroids, corticosteroids are used primarily to treat inflammatory conditions, such as asthma, arthritis, and allergies. They work by suppressing the immune system and reducing inflammation, rather than promoting muscle growth.

Common Anabolic Steroids

Some popular anabolic steroids include:

  • Testosterone: The primary male sex hormone that promotes muscle development and overall masculine traits.
  • Nandrolone: Known for its ability to enhance muscle size and strength while minimizing androgenic side effects.
  • Stanozolol: Frequently used in cutting cycles to preserve lean muscle mass while reducing body fat.
  • Oxandrolone: Often utilized for its mild nature, making it suitable for both men and women.

Uses of Steroids

Steroids have legitimate medical applications, including:

  • Treatment of delayed puberty in boys.
  • Management of muscle wasting diseases (e.g., cancer, HIV).
  • Treatment of certain forms of anemia.
  • Reduction of inflammation in autoimmune diseases.

Despite these legitimate uses, many individuals misuse anabolic steroids for aesthetic or performance-enhancing purposes. Athletes may seek a competitive edge, while others desire improved physical appearance.

Benefits of Steroid Use

The potential benefits of anabolic steroids include:

  • Increased Muscle Mass: Users often experience rapid increases in muscle size, making them appealing for bodybuilders and athletes.
  • Enhanced Recovery: Steroids can decrease recovery time between workouts, allowing for more frequent training sessions.
  • Improved Strength: Many users report significant gains in strength, enabling better performance in various sports.
  • Boosted Confidence: Enhanced physical appearance can lead to improved self-esteem and confidence levels.

Risks and Side Effects

While steroids may offer short-term benefits, they also pose numerous health risks. Some common side effects include:

  • Cardiovascular Issues: Steroid use can increase the risk of heart disease, hypertension, and stroke.
  • Liver Damage: Oral anabolic steroids can cause liver toxicity and other complications.
  • Hormonal Imbalances: Males may experience decreased natural testosterone production, leading to testicular shrinkage, infertility, and gynecomastia. Women may develop masculine traits, such as increased body hair and a deeper voice.
  • Psychiatric Effects: Users may face mood swings, aggression, and symptoms of depression or anxiety.

Legal Implications

The legality of steroid use varies by country and region. In many places, anabolic steroids are classified as controlled substances, making unauthorized possession, distribution, or use illegal. Medical prescriptions are often required for legitimate medical use. It is essential for individuals to be aware of the laws governing steroids in their respective areas to avoid legal repercussions.
